No.
Polystyrene Styrofoam is a number 7 plastic. Many Styrofoam containers are stamped as recyclable, but our Materials Recovery Facility can only process plastics numbered 1 - 6.
Styrofoam, including takeaway containers, meat trays and packaging should be placed in your general waste bin or reused around the home.
